Hi all,

Quick heads-up from the front desk at Torvane House: over the holiday week the main doors will be locked from 18:00 instead of 22:00, and reception won't be staffed after 17:00. Night shift folks, you'll still get in fine through the courtyard entrance — just remember the main lobby won't buzz you through. Use the courtyard keypad with the code below.

door code, tahop-fahap: bdg-JZCXMY-37375484

Ticket: Cursor pagination in the public Orchard Ledger REST API returns duplicate records when clients page backward across a deletion boundary. Repro: create 30 records, delete record 15, then request the previous page using the cursor from page two. Records 13 and 14 appear twice. Proposed fix normalizes cursors against the tombstone index rather than raw offsets. Tests added in the pagination suite; please review the boundary cases carefully. The failing run's identifier is captured below.

build token for kagaf-hahof: htk14_9d3d4d26d7d8de

## Who to ping: zero-downtime schema migrations

If your change touches the Copperline primary DB, loop in the Migrations Guild before the weekly sync — they'll sanity-check your expand/contract plan and book a window. Small additive columns usually get same-day approval; anything dropping or renaming needs a dry run on staging first. For quick questions or to grab a review slot, reach the guild at the address below.

escalation mailbox, kahog-bafog: ralwyn_quenael@zemvarsys.corp